> 5) Since I use TeX/LaTeX I ask:
> 
> does Texlive work on openbsd, and does tlmgr work too?
> 
> (I read that there are issues).

Basically all you have to do is to install your preferred flavor of
texlive from ports and it will just work.[1]

If by texlive you mean the one supplied by https://tug.org/texlive,
you can use the custom binary set build by Nelson Beebe.  Instructions
on how to do this can be found here:

   https://tug.org/texlive/custom-bin.html

and you will find Nelson Beebe's binary sets for OpenBSD here:

    https://ftp.math.utah.edu/pub/texlive-utah/bin/

Once this is done, you can use texlive pretty much in the same way as
under Linux and update it with tlmgr.

This is what I do.  Either way, you will have to install biber by
yourself.
